Inner Space host Dr. Barbara explores the most important topic of our time – emotional health and well-being – by starting with inspiring and compelling stories from the world of entertainment and music. She moves beyond the “celebrity” focus to talking with three good friends about the importance of taking care of ourselves emotionally – and those we love. Dr. Barbara sits down with DJ Nash, the charismatic creator of ABC’s hit series A Million Little Things, Talinda Bennington mental health advocate and the wife of Linkin Park's Chester Bennington who died by suicide, and Ben Foster critically acclaimed actor of screen and stage. All three guests are talented, inspiring and invested in removing the discomfort we so often feel about our mental health – and in being of service to others in need. Albums of the Week: Matt: The Sleeping - Questions and Answers (2006) Grant: Jimmy Eat World - Bleed American Main Topics Thursday’s Geoff Rickly Shares Thoughts On Why Singers Have High Suicide Rates Following the death of Linkin Park's Chester Bennington, one fan reached out to Rickly asking if he had any insights on why this seems to happen in the industry along with asking "How do we help people who (from an outside view) seem to have it all?” Rickly responded with an amazing note that went into detail about the pressures that singers have to face, along with the environment that all band members find themselves in. It's impossible to pigeonhole this band's musical genre. And you certainly cannot underestimate their wide range of songwriting abilities. Each of their albums are so completely different from one another. Linkin Park is simply a remarkable groups of talented individuals. One of the best bands to experience live, too.I recently had the opportunity to participate in a press conference call (representing the Chicago Music Guide) with two of those members - Chester & Mike. Both guys were very forthright with their answers. Linkin Park has been touring the world promoting their current album "Minutes To Midnight" . Their North American leg of the tour begins Febuary 12, 2008. You'll hear a lot of juicy details about this tour, also their view on collaborating, songwriting, what it was like to work with legendary producer Rick Ruben, and much much more!
